目前所在的公司用的是JDK8,并且在开发和框架中用了大量的JDK8的新特性,Stream方法就是接口Collection中的default方法。这篇文章整理一下JDK8中对于Interface的改进和升级。static方法Java8中为Interface新增了一项功能,可以在Interface中定义一个或者更多个静态方法,用法和普通的static方法一样。代码示例:public interface
# Python参数的长度获取方法
## 1. 介绍
在Python编程中,我们经常需要获取参数的长度。参数的长度是指参数所包含元素的个数或者字符串的长度。但是,有一些情况下,我们可能会遇到获取参数长度的困惑。本篇文章将详细介绍如何在Python中获取参数的长度。
## 2. 解决方案
为了解决这个问题,我们可以按照以下步骤进行操作。
| 步骤 | 描述 |
| --- | --- |
原创
2023-08-20 09:29:23
59阅读
## 如何解决“Python 没法用pip”问题
### 问题描述
在Python开发过程中,我们经常会使用pip来安装和管理第三方库。但有时候会遇到“Python 没法用pip”的问题,这时候就需要进行相应的处理来解决这个问题。
### 解决流程
首先,我们需要了解在安装Python的过程中,pip是如何被安装的。然后我们可以通过一系列步骤来解决这个问题。下面是整个解决流程的步骤表格:
# Python中copy()方法不能深度拷贝的原因及解决方法
在Python中,我们经常会使用copy()方法来复制一个对象。然而,有时候我们需要对对象进行深度拷贝,即复制对象及其所有嵌套对象的内容。但是,在Python中,使用copy()方法进行深拷贝并不总是有效的。本文将介绍为什么copy()方法不能深度拷贝以及如何解决这个问题。
## 为什么copy()方法不能深度拷贝
在Pytho
## 解决VSCode激活Python没法跳转的问题
在使用VSCode编辑器编写Python代码时,有时候会遇到激活Python环境后无法跳转到定义或者跳转到引用的情况。这会给我们的代码编写带来一些不便,但是这个问题其实是可以很容易解决的。
### 问题分析
首先,我们需要了解这个问题出现的原因。在VSCode中,跳转到定义或者跳转到引用功能是依赖于Python环境的。如果Python环境
Python是一种功能强大的编程语言,但在其早期版本中存在一个问题,即无法直接下载安装。这给许多开发者带来了困扰,因为他们不得不通过其他途径获取Python,比如手动编译源代码。在当时,这给使用Python的用户带来了不便。
幸运的是,随着时间的推移和Python社区的发展,这个问题已经得到了解决。现在,用户可以通过各种渠道轻松地下载和安装Python,无需再经历繁琐的步骤。
让我们来看一下如
# 如何解决“jupyter 没法执行python”问题
## 流程图:
```mermaid
flowchart TD;
A[问题:jupyter 没法执行python] --> B{解决方法};
B --> C[检查环境配置];
C --> D[安装jupyter插件];
D --> E[重启jupyter];
E --> F[尝试执行python代
# Python中的sys.path问题
在Python中,`sys.path`是一个包含了Python解释器搜索模块的路径列表。当我们导入一个模块时,Python解释器会按照`sys.path`列表中的顺序逐个查找模块。然而,有时候我们会遇到`sys.path`无法打包的问题。
## 问题背景
当我们使用Python编写一个较大的项目,并且希望将其打包成一个可执行文件或者库时,我们通常会使
原创
2023-08-17 13:01:04
115阅读
## Python 函数参数没法获取长度
Python 是一门非常强大的编程语言,它提供了许多高级功能和灵活性。在 Python 中,函数是非常重要的概念之一。函数可以接受不同类型和数量的参数,这使得函数的使用非常灵活。然而,有一个常见的误解是函数参数可以轻松地获取其长度。实际上,Python 函数参数本身没有固定的长度。在本文中,我们将深入探讨这个问题,并提供一些解决方案。
### 函数参数
原创
2023-08-18 16:57:23
20阅读
# 项目中无法引用系统 Python 库的解决方案
在开发中,有时会遇到项目无法引用系统安装的 Python 库的问题。这种情况通常由于环境配置不当导致。本篇文章将指导你如何一步一步解决这个问题。
## 整体解决流程
首先,让我们梳理一下整个流程。下面是一个简单的步骤表格:
| 步骤 | 操作 | 说明
这个错误是由配置引起的,关闭vscode,ctrl+H显示配置文件,在/home/user/.config下,删除这个文件夹(里面包含错误的配置),/home/user/.config/code然后就可以正常配置vscode了。
原创
2022-01-13 10:44:08
1897阅读
[root@yyjk flask]# cat mojo.py# !/usr/bin/env python# -*- coding: utf-8 -*-from flask import Flask,reques...
转载
2017-12-22 09:14:00
241阅读
2评论
# Python中iloc之后没法除法运算的解决方案
作为一名经验丰富的开发者,我很高兴能够帮助刚入行的小白解决Python中iloc之后没法进行除法运算的问题。在这篇文章中,我将详细介绍整个流程,并通过表格和代码示例来解释每一步的操作。
## 流程概述
首先,让我们通过一个表格来概述整个流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入所需的库 |
| 2
# Python 包存在了但是没法引用?一文带你解决
在 Python 开发过程中,我们经常会遇到一个令人头疼的问题:明明已经安装了所需的包,但是代码中却无法引用。这可能是由于多种原因造成的,本文将为你详细解析这一问题,并提供一些实用的解决方案。
## 问题原因分析
1. **环境问题**:Python 有多个版本,每个版本都有自己的包管理器(如 pip3)。如果安装了 Python 3.x
Blender有很多互连数据类型,它有一个自动生成的引用api,它通常有您需要编写脚本的信息,但是很难使用。 本文档旨在帮助您了解如何使用参考api。 1 Reference API Scope 参考API覆盖了bpy.types,这里面存储了可以通过bpy.context(用户上下文)和bpy.data(Blend数据文件)获取的类型。 bge, bmes
目录1.系统运行环境2.系统功能介绍3.项目结构和问题略讲3.1 乱码问题3.2 如何将GBK编码系统修改为UTF-8编码的系统?3.3项目结构3.4 项目修改3.5 项目运行 3.6 代码片段4.总结1.系统运行环境 运行环境:Java8 + MySQL8 &
# 通过client打开HFSS 没法交互
HFSS是一款强大的电磁仿真软件,广泛应用于天线设计、微波器件设计等领域。在进行仿真过程中,有时候需要通过Python脚本来控制HFSS进行自动化仿真。然而,有些用户在使用Python通过client打开HFSS时发现无法进行交互操作,这可能是由于一些配置问题导致的。本文将介绍如何通过Python client打开HFSS并进行交互操作。
## HF
# 在Jupyter中实现只查看Python代码不能运行的功能
## 引言
在数据科学与编程领域,Jupyter Notebook是一个功能强大的工具,通常用于编写和运行Python代码。然而,有时我们希望将Jupyter Notebook设置成只允许查看代码而不运行,以保护代码的知识产权,或者避免不小心运行代码造成的错误。本文将引导你实现这个功能,帮助你完成这一任务。
## 实现流程
我
目录1. Python简介1.1 Python命令行模式和交互模式1.2 Python解释器和文本编辑器2.Python基础2.1 数据类型:整数(d)、浮点数(f)、字符串(s)、布尔值、空值(None)、常量2.2 字符串与编码2.3 list 和tuple2.4 条件判断: if, elif, else2.5 循环2.6 dic字典和set集合3.函数3.1 定义函数3.2 函数的参数4.
转载
2023-10-19 07:10:09
16阅读
这个错误是由配置引起的,关闭vscode, ctrl+H 显示配置文件,在/home/user/.config下,删除这个文件夹(里面包含错误的配置), /home/user/.config/code 然后就可以正常配置vscode了。
原创
2021-12-07 17:06:44
10000+阅读